12.3 Tightening torque

Component
Comment
Tightening torque
in Nm
Fixing screws (top burner trim)
fig. 4-31, item 1
3
Fixing screw (burner flange / boiler body)
fig. 7-1, item 13
6
Safety screw (Venturi nozzle)
fig. 7-1, item 2
3
Fixing screw (ignition electrodes / ionisation electrode)
fig. 7-1, item 18
3
Fixing screw (burner blower / burner flange)
fig. 7-1, item 12
6
Fixing screw (burner blower / burner adapter)
fig. 7-1, item 14
4
Fixing screw (safety gas control block / gas connection line)
fig. 7-2, item 15
2
Temperature sensor and sensors
all
Max. 10
Hydraulic line connections (Water)
Thread 1"
25 - 30
Tab. 12-7 Tightening torque
